Identifying Top Developers

What the interview process can and cannot tell you


April 01, 2008
URL:http://www.drdobbs.com/architecture-and-design/identifying-top-developers/207001122

Christopher writes about computer languages at Dr. Dobb's Code Talk. He can be contacted at [email protected].


Most companies realize that having top-notch software developers can have a significant impact on the success of their software projects. So how do you identify the best software developers during the hiring process?

Many companies realize that the difference in productivity between a "rock-star" programmer and an average performer can be huge, by a factor of 10:100. As a result many companies are desperate to attract the creme-de-la-creme of programmers. However, most job interviews are constructed in a manner that overlooks many excellent candidates.

The following is a list of tips for how to improve your interview process when looking for top-notch programmers:

In summary my advice is to try and recreate the working environment when interviewing and evaluating programmers. Try and give them every opportunity to expose their qualities. No matter how much opportunity you give them, mediochre programmers will simply never really impress you, but the really talented people will sometimes only shine brightly if you have aim the light just right.

Terms of Service | Privacy Statement | Copyright © 2024 UBM Tech, All rights reserved.